1. Setaria italica, commonly known as Italian millet, is a cultivated cereal grass that has been used as a staple food in parts of Asia, Africa, and Europe for thousands of years. Its small, round seeds are highly nutritious and provide a good source of protein, carbohydrates, dietary fiber, and essential vitamins and minerals. It is also a versatile crop that can be used to make various dishes, including porridge, bread, and even desserts.

2. Setaria italica is a hardy and fast-growing grass that can withstand drought and is tolerant of a wide range of soil types. Its attractive green-blue foliage and its ability to self-seed make it a popular choice for landscaping. It also makes a great cover crop to help protect soil from erosion, as well as to enrich and improve its fertility.

3. The seeds of Setaria italica are highly nutritious and have a nutty, sweet flavor. They are rich in B vitamins, including thiamin, riboflavin, and niacin, and are also an excellent source of dietary fiber, protein, and minerals, such as iron, calcium, phosphorus, potassium, and magnesium.
